The Architectural Foundation: Deconstructing Burberry’s Design Ethos

To understand the versatility of Burberry heels, one must first appreciate the brand’s foundational pillars. Burberry, founded in 1856 by Thomas Burberry, is historically anchored in functionality, most famously through the invention of gabardine—a breathable, weatherproof fabric. This legacy of practical innovation permeates its contemporary footwear. The design philosophy often marries this British pragmatism with a refined aesthetic sensibility. As the fashion critic Sarah Mower once noted in Vogue, “Burberry’s genius lies in its ability to make the practical poetic.” This is evident in their heels: a stiletto may feature a water-resistant treated leather, or a block heel might be designed with a hidden, ergonomic insole for all-day comfort. From a materials science perspective, the selection of calfskin, suede, and innovative technical fabrics is never arbitrary; it is a calculated decision for durability, texture, and seasonal appropriateness. The iconic check, often used as a lining or a subtle accent, is not merely a logo but a signifier of a lineage—a shorthand for a specific kind of understated, confident British style. This objective blend of form and function provides the scientific basis for their trans-seasonal appeal. The heel is not an afterthought but a carefully engineered component, with pitch and distribution of weight analyzed to provide stability, making elegance feel, quite literally, effortless.

Spring: Awakening with Subtle Prints and Pastel Hues

Spring styling is an exercise in renewal and lightness. The key is to mirror the season’s gentle transition without overwhelming the senses. Here, Burberry heels in lighter materials or featuring the iconic Nova Check in miniature become invaluable. Pairing a beige-checked kitten heel with a crisp, white midi dress and a lightweight trench creates a monochromatic yet textured look that is both fresh and intellectually sophisticated. The check provides just enough visual interest without competing with the simplicity of the dress. From a color theory standpoint, pastels—think blush, sky blue, or mint—work harmoniously with Burberry’s foundational beige and black palette. A pair of pale pink suede Burberry heels can be the bridge between a tailored navy trouser suit and a silk camisole, softening the structured silhouette with a touch of romantic color. As style influencer Camille Charrière often articulates on her platform, “Spring is about layering lightness.” A practical tip is to consider the shoe’s finish; a matte leather or suede absorbs light softly, complementing the diffuse quality of spring sunlight, whereas a patent leather might be reserved for sharper, cooler spring days. The goal is an outfit that feels like a breath of fresh air, where the heel adds a definitive point of polish rather than a heavy accent.

Summer: Balancing Structure with Breezy Effortlessness

Summer presents the paradox of maintaining elegance amidst a desire for ease and coolness. The misconception is that elegance must be forfeited for comfort. Burberry heels, particularly styles like a sleek sandal-heel or an open-toe mule, dismantle this false binary. The scientific principle at play here is visual weight. A slender-strapped sandal with a moderate heel, in a neutral tone, provides the elevation and finish of a heel while maintaining a high degree of ventilation and a light visual footprint. It pairs as effortlessly with a flowing maxi dress as it does with tailored linen shorts and a structured blazer for a more polished daytime look. As Diane von Furstenberg famously said, “Style is something each of us already has; all we need to do is find it.” Finding your summer style often involves letting the clothing flow and allowing the footwear to anchor. A metallic Burberry heels sandal can catch the summer light beautifully, acting as jewelry for the feet. The material choice is critical: treated leathers that resist moisture and stains, or woven textiles that are inherently breathable, align with Burberry’s heritage of practical luxury. This season is about intelligent choices—opting for designs that offer support and style without compromising on the liberated feeling summer demands.

Autumn: The Mastery of Texture and Layering

Autumn is the season where fashion truly thinks, playing with depth, texture, and rich narratives. It is the ideal canvas for Burberry’s deeper strengths. Here, heels in rich burgundy, forest green, or classic black suede or leather come to the fore. The styling moves into the realm of tactile layering. Imagine a pair of black leather block-heel ankle boots—a quintessential autumn staple from Burberry—paired with opaque tights, a tweed midi skirt, a cashmere sweater, and the iconic trench coat. This is texture-on-texture dressing, a concept frequently explored in fashion curricula at institutions like Central Saint Martins, where the interaction of different materials creates a sophisticated, cohesive whole. The block heel provides unwavering stability on uneven autumn pavements, a practical consideration born of design intelligence. Author and style commentator Tory Burch once reflected, “Luxury is the attention to detail, the quality, the craftsmanship.” This is palpable in an autumn ensemble centered around Burberry heels. The detail might be the precise stitching on the heel, the quality of the suede that holds its nap, or the way the heel’s color picks up a secondary hue in your plaid scarf. Styling becomes an exercise in creating a rich, sensory experience where the heel is both a foundational element and a key textural component.

Winter: Defying the Elements with Polished Resilience

Winter challenges the very notion of elegant footwear, but it is a challenge Burberry’s design history is uniquely equipped to meet. The focus shifts to boots and closed-toe pumps crafted from resilient materials. A knee-high leather boot with a sharp, manageable heel transforms a practical necessity into a style statement. It can be worn over skinny jeans tucked in or under a wide-leg wool trouser, offering both warmth and a seamless line. The scientific explanation lies in material technology: weather-proofing treatments, insulated linings, and grippy, yet discreet, sole materials. Styling for winter is about creating a capsule where each piece is both functional and refined. A sleek black leather pump, perhaps with a metallic heel cap detail, can be your indoor savior—elegantly carried in a tote to replace snow boots at the office or a dinner venue. This practice, often highlighted by organization experts like Marie Kondo in the context of a curated wardrobe, speaks to intentional living. Your Burberry heels in winter are not just shoes; they are part of a system that allows you to navigate the elements without sacrificing your aesthetic identity. Pair them with thick, fine-gauge tights in a complementary dark hue, a wool crepe dress, and a structured coat for a look that is as formidable against the cold as it is commanding in its elegance.
